WebDec 3, 2024 · When a bank builds allowances through provision expense, net income is reduced and that reduces capital. Consequently, as capital is generally considered a costly funding source, loans that carry larger allowances under CECL (as compared to ILM) become more expensive to underwrite. 4 In response, banks may change their lending … WebJul 11, 2024 · Perform Outcomes Analysis. WebApr 13, 2024 · Credit loss estimation requirements. CECL is often described as a lifetime loss estimate because it requires organizations to estimate loss risk over the expected life of the financial asset—no longer just when the risk of loss is “probable.”. Expected life may be thought of as the contractual term of the financial asset, adjusted ...
